Frequently Asked Questions
How much does a 350W Risen Energy Hyperion 350W cost?
The Risen Energy Hyperion 350W costs approximately $455 per panel ($$1.30/W). A typical 7kW system using this panel would cost around $9,100 before incentives. After the 30% federal tax credit, your net cost drops to $6,370.
Is the Risen Energy Hyperion 350W a good solar panel?
The Risen Energy Hyperion 350W has 17.3% efficiency and a 10 years warranty, placing it in the budget tier. This is a solid mid-range panel suitable for most residential installations.
How many Risen Energy Hyperion 350W panels do I need?
For a typical 7kW residential system, you'd need approximately 20 panels. For a 10kW system, plan for about 29 panels. The exact number depends on your roof space, energy usage, and local sun hours.
